When You've Stopped Growing with Your Executive Coach
"A few months ago, a client sat across from me and said, "I'm not sure I'm getting what I need from this anymore." He had come to me for coaching a year earlier in an effort to make partner at his firm. He had since done that, earlier than expected, and now felt adrift. "I've achieved the goal," he said, "so what's next?""
